Air China will continue to add capacity to its China-Europe routes. Starting March 29, Air China will increase its Beijing-Milan services to daily, and starting June 1, it will increase its Beijing-Paris services to twice daily.

The new flight numbers on the Beijing-Milan route are CA949/50. The outbound flight departs Beijing at 13:30 and arrives in Milan at 19:00 local time; the return flight leaves Milan at 21:00 local time and arrives in Beijing at 13:30 the following day. The new flight numbers on the Beijing – Paris route are CA875/6. The outbound flight departs Beijing at 02:05 and arrives in Paris at 07:25 local time; the return flight leaves Paris at 14:10 local time and arrives in Beijing at 06:30 the following day.

The two routes are operated with A330-200 aircraft.
